WHAT ARE YOU DOING TONIGHT Here’s to all that write poetry in a traditional style. Rhythm and rhyme flowing freely impart pictures all the while. ~ Stories will fill up your pages rewritten time after time. Your mind searches and gages when in your heart is the rhyme. ~ The waste can overflowing with poems just not good enough but the seed ever-growing even though the draft is rough. ~ Crumpled paper on the floor is hiding your feet from sight. By the way, may I implore; what are you doing tonight? ©10/23/08 ![]()
